1 Striving to know, love, and serve God in all others. The word we use to describe the presence of Christ in what we receive at Holy Communion is real. Now, on this day, many homilies will repeat and defend this reality with the homilist s fist pounding. While they are correct that the presence is real, this should require minimal defense because the evidence of the real presence is so strong and obvious. In fact, there are two reasons that are often overlooked that very clearly take the need for convincing anyone out of the equation. First, Jesus Christ said, This is my Body and This is my Blood. He did not say This represents my Body or Blood. Simple. Christ himself equates himself with Bread and Wine. This means that His substance that is His Body is in the appearance of the bread and His substance that is His Divine Blood is in the appearance of the Wine. Never does he use the words sign or symbol; rather, he says, is. We call this the mystery of transubstantiation because the substance of Christ crosses over into the appearance of bread and wine to become the Bread of Life and the Wine of Salvation which is given to us for nourishment that we may transubstantiated, too that we might become His Body, and that His Divine Blood may pump in our human hearts. The second reason that we know this is true is that we can see this happening! Throughout the world, the people who consume this nourishment become an astonishing thing they truly and really become the Body of Christ. The world over is full of examples of the power of God working through the members of the Body of Christ: to feed the hungry, to visit the sick, to catechize those who do not know Christ, to pass on the wealth we receive in Christ in turn to those who may lack it. In every parish may this be so may the account of our stewardship be one of building ministries focused strongly and solely on Christ rather than our own kingdoms of vanity and ego. May we, in serving, be aware that this is a reality that Christ has called us to be his very self in the world. May the Body and Blood of Christ make us powerful in light, light that is really His light May we, with every consumption of the Body and Blood of Christ, become more His and may the world be sanctified because of the Body and Blood that you are. This is the greatest evidence that this is all real that you and I are all these things because we consume what is really God. Your servant in Our Blessed Lord, Fr. Question of the Week: As Catholics we believe in the transformation of bread and wine into the Body and Blood of Christ. How does this reality transform me? Knowing: At Mass we do what Jesus did at the Passover meal. When we gather for Mass the bread and wine become the Body and Blood of Jesus. Every time we take part in the celebration of the Eucharist, Jesus is present. In the Eucharist, Christ is really and truly made present. The Eucharistic celebration is a memorial of Jesus death and resurrection. It is a sacrament of love. The Eucharist is the center of our Christian faith and life. Loving: The Passover foreshadows another passover - Jesus own passing over from suffering and death to risen Life. And yet another passover: our passing over from old self to new self, from life of sin to life of grace. Each Eucharist, each time we eat and drink the Body and Blood of Christ, we embrace anew our passing over to new Life in Christ. Serving: In the beginning of today s Gospel, Jesus instructs his disciples to make preparations for the Passover meal. Like most meals, the Passover required planning and preparation. Just as we take time to prepare for significant events in our lives, our celebration of the Sunday Eucharist also requires planning and preparation. Little acts of self-giving among the people with whom we live and work is preparation for sharing in the Eucharist and receiving eternal Life. Special Collection Next Weekend Catholic Communications Campaign The essential mission of the CCC is to contribute to the process of evangelization by fostering activities in relation to television, radio, internet, and other media, and through special projects of the Catholic press. An annual collection is taken up in the dioceses, which remit 50% of the funds collected to the National Office. From these funds, grants are made by the USCCB Subcommittee on the Catholic Communication Campaign. The remaining portion of the collection is retained by the dioceses for use in local communication projects. Please place any contributions for this campaign in the one weekly collection at Masses.
